在现代微型计算机系统中,存储器的设计和布局是影响整体性能的重要因素之一。为了满足不同的应用场景和需求,计算机通常会配备多种类型的存储设备,从高速缓存到大容量硬盘。然而,在这些存储器中,究竟哪一种能够提供最快的存取速度呢?
首先,我们需要了解微型计算机中的主要存储器类型及其特性。常见的存储器包括寄存器、高速缓存(Cache)、主内存(RAM)以及外存(如硬盘或固态硬盘)。其中,寄存器位于CPU内部,是离处理器最近且速度最快的存储单元。它们用于临时保存运算数据或指令,是CPU执行操作时最直接的数据来源。寄存器的数量有限,但其存取时间可以达到纳秒级别,因此堪称整个计算机系统中最快速的存储器。
其次,紧随其后的是高速缓存。高速缓存分为L1、L2和L3级,分别位于CPU内部的不同层级。L1缓存是距离CPU核心最近的一层,容量较小但存取速度极快;L2缓存稍慢一些,而L3缓存则服务于多个核心共享使用。高速缓存的设计目的是弥补主内存与CPU之间速度差异,通过提前加载常用数据来提升运行效率。尽管高速缓存的速度不及寄存器,但它仍然比主内存快得多。
再来看主内存(RAM),它作为计算机的核心存储部件,负责暂存操作系统、应用程序以及用户数据。虽然RAM的存取速度远高于外存设备,但相比寄存器和高速缓存,它的延迟较高,存取时间通常在几十纳秒至几百纳秒之间。因此,RAM并非微型计算机中存取速度最快的部分。
最后,我们提到外存设备,如传统机械硬盘或新型固态硬盘。这类存储器主要用于长期存储数据,其存取速度远远低于其他类型的存储器。例如,机械硬盘的寻道时间和旋转延迟可能导致存取时间达到毫秒级别,而固态硬盘虽然提升了性能,但依然无法与寄存器或高速缓存相提并论。
综上所述,在微型计算机中,存取速度最快的存储器无疑是寄存器。它们以极高的速度支持着CPU的高效运转,成为整个系统性能优化的关键所在。尽管高速缓存、主内存和外存也在各自的领域发挥重要作用,但在追求极致速度的场景下,寄存器始终占据着无可替代的地位。
希望本文能帮助您更好地理解微型计算机中存储器的工作原理及特点!